How Modern Audio Transcription Works
AI-Powered Speech Recognition Explained
Modern transcription systems leverage neural networks trained on millions of hours of human speech to recognize patterns in audio waves and convert them into text. These AI models process sound frequencies, identify phonemes, and match them against vast linguistic databases in milliseconds. The technology has evolved from rule-based systems requiring perfect pronunciation to adaptive algorithms that learn from context and correct errors automatically. Today’s leading platforms achieve 95-98% accuracy rates even with diverse accents, background noise, and overlapping conversations. Real-time processing capabilities enable instant text generation during live meetings, while post-processing systems can refine accuracy through multiple analysis passes and contextual corrections.

Video to Text Conversion Essentials
Video transcription extracts audio tracks from meeting recordings and applies advanced speech recognition algorithms to generate synchronized text. Speaker identification technology analyzes vocal patterns, pitch variations, and speaking cadences to distinguish between participants and label their contributions automatically. Modern systems handle multiple input formats including MP4, AVI, and streaming protocols from platforms like Zoom, Teams, and Google Meet. Direct integration with conferencing software enables automatic recording initiation and seamless transcript delivery to participants’ inboxes within minutes of meeting conclusion, eliminating manual upload steps and reducing processing delays.

Overcoming Implementation Challenges
Data privacy compliance requires selecting transcription services with SOC 2 Type II certification and implementing role-based access controls that restrict transcript visibility to authorized personnel only. Technical jargon and industry acronyms challenge AI accuracy, but leading platforms offer custom vocabulary training where administrators upload company-specific terminology to improve recognition rates by 15-20%. Multi-speaker differentiation improves through voice enrollment sessions where participants speak for 30-60 seconds, enabling the system to learn individual vocal patterns and reduce speaker confusion errors. Version control becomes critical when multiple team members edit transcripts simultaneously – implement automated backup systems that preserve original AI-generated versions alongside human-edited copies with timestamp tracking. Training teams on new workflows requires structured rollouts starting with pilot groups, followed by hands-on workshops demonstrating recording initiation, transcript review processes, and search functionality to ensure organization-wide adoption success.
